What is Tourist Tax Form
The Tourist Tax Omission Statement is a government form used by hotel guests in Rimini, Italy, to declare their decision not to pay the tourist tax.

What is the Tourist Tax Omission Statement?
The Tourist Tax Omission Statement is an essential document for hotel guests in Rimini, Italy, allowing them to declare their non-payment of the tourist tax. This form serves as a formal declaration, enabling eligible guests to pursue an exemption based on specific criteria. The statement requires detailed personal information and accommodation specifics, ensuring a comprehensive submission.
